Some scholars point out that modern architecture has been comprised of two parallel currents from its very beginning: rational and organic. Although many interpretations of modernism highlight industrial standardisation and mass production, Bruno Zevi suggested that the basic ideas of functionalism already included the principles of organic architecture. Start by choosing materials that speak to nature’s palette: wood, stone, and metals.Mar 20, 2024 · Organic modern designs start with a foundation of clean lines, rounded shapes, and smooth surfaces. These elements are then accentuated with natural materials, including reclaimed wood, stone, leather, linen, burnished metal, and concrete, to introduce texture and an organic feel. Organic Modernism conforms to the modernist vernacular in that it shuns the use of disingenuous ornamentation preferring instead to draw aesthetic pleasure from the structural form.
